The purple/dark-leaved flowering Plum/Cherry is popular for its rich, deep-purple leaves throughout spring and summer and stems that are almost black. The foliage provides brilliant interest to any space and looks striking alone, or underplanted with lighter foliage planting. In spring, an abundance of double, pink flowers bloom, alonside new, bronze leaves. In autumn before the leaves fall, they turn shades of red and orange. This Plum Cherry has a rounded form and will grow up to 5m in height, by 3m wide. Will tolerate most conditions apart from very wet or shallow, chalky soil.
